What replaces the Analysis ToolPak in Google Sheets?

The Analysis ToolPak adds statistical and engineering functions in Excel. Google Sheets includes many stats functions natively; gaps use add-ons or Connected Sheets to BigQuery. Check function names before assuming ToolPak is required.

When to use it

Use built-in stats functions or add-ons when Excel ToolPak ran regressions or histograms.

When to skip it

Skip ToolPak ports when a pivot or QUERY already summarizes the sample you need.
